Abstract

The utility model discloses a circuit electrode etches partially metal sheet, which comprises a plate body, four summit positions of plate body are equipped with the fillet, the plate body middle part is equipped with the disk, the disk passes through the splice bar and connects arc -shaped strip, the disk evenly is equipped with 3 splice bars along the circumferencial direction, arc -shaped strip passes through the connecting block and connects the plate body, form annular through groove between disk and the arc -shaped strip, be equipped with the arc elongated slot between arc -shaped strip and the plate body, be equipped with u shape opening between the adjacent arc -shaped strip, plate body reverse side structure all is levels, the positive position of plate body disk, splice bar and arc -shaped strip place plane are less than plate body place plane. Compared with the prior art, the utility model discloses simple structure, it is convenient to use, and long service life is and low in manufacturing cost.

Description

A kind of circuit electrode half-etching metallic plate
Technical field
The utility model relates to a kind of metallic plate, is specifically related to a kind of circuit electrode half-etching metallic plate.
Background technology
Circuit electrode metallic plate is mainly used on the equipment such as battery, battery is generally fixed in battery tray, battery tray two ends are placing battery Anode and battery negative pole respectively, the position corresponding with anode and battery cathode, battery tray two ends is provided with circuit connection, by circuit connection, battery is connected, and battery tray is exactly mainly by the wiring of circuit motor metallic plate connecting circuit, circuit motor metallic plate all adopts electric conducting material to make, but in prior art, circuit electrode metallic plate adopts sheet entity structure mostly, sheet center is sunk structure, it is convenient not to use, connection reliability is not good, for the problems referred to above, ad hoc meter the utility model is solved.
Utility model content
The purpose of this utility model is to provide a kind of structure simple, easy to use, long service life and the circuit electrode half-etching metallic plate of low cost of manufacture.
For achieving the above object, the utility model provides following technical scheme:
A kind of circuit electrode half-etching metallic plate, comprise plate body, plate body four vertex positions are provided with fillet, disk is provided with in the middle part of plate body, disk connects arc strip by dowel, disk is along the circumferential direction evenly provided with 3 dowels, arc strip connects plate body by contiguous block, annular through groove is formed between disk and arc strip, arc elongated slot is provided with between arc strip and plate body, be provided with u shape opening between adjacent arc strip, plate body inverse layer structure is all levels, and plate body front position disk, dowel and arc strip place plane are lower than plate body place plane.
As the further improvement of above-mentioned technology, described plate body is square structure.
As the further improvement of above-mentioned technology, described plate body length is 16mm, and plate body width is 16mm, and plate body thickness is 0.3mm.
As the further improvement of above-mentioned technology, described radius of corner is 1mm.
As the further improvement of above-mentioned technology, described disk diameter is 5.5mm.
As the further improvement of above-mentioned technology, described plate body front position disk, dowel and arc strip place plane are lower than plate body place plane 0.05mm.
Compared with prior art, the beneficial effects of the utility model are: be provided with disk in the middle part of plate body, disk can play the effect of connection circuit, disk is connected on arc strip by dowel, annular gap is formed between disk and arc strip, while guarantee structural strength and connection characteristic, material can be saved, structure is easier, arc elongated slot is provided with between arc strip and plate body, u shape opening is provided with between adjacent arc strip, at plate body reverse side position disk, dowel and arc strip are all in plate body on same level height, plate body front position disk, dowel and arc strip adopt sink structures design, then disk, dowel and arc strip and plate body place plane reduce 0.05mm, be more applicable for the joint of battery, connect more solid and reliable, connection characteristic is better.
Accompanying drawing explanation
Fig. 1 is vertical view of the present utility model.
Fig. 2 is front view of the present utility model.
Fig. 3 is end view of the present utility model.
Fig. 4 is structural representation of the present utility model.
In figure: 1-plate body, 2-fillet, 3-disk, 4-dowel, 5-arc strip, 6-annular through groove, 7-arc elongated slot, 8-u shape opening.
Embodiment
Be described in more detail below in conjunction with the technical scheme of embodiment to this patent.
A kind of circuit electrode half-etching metallic plate, comprise plate body 1, plate body 1 is square structure, plate body 1 length is 16mm, plate body 1 width is 16mm, plate body 1 thickness is 0.3mm, plate body 1 thinner thickness, it is more convenient to be suitable for, plate body 1 four vertex positions are provided with fillet 2, fillet 2 radius is 1mm, fillet 2 structure is adopted to make plate body 1 four vertex positions rounder and more smooth, can not produce sharp-pointed, disk 3 is provided with in the middle part of plate body 1, disk 3 diameter is 5.5mm, disk 3 connects arc strip 5 by dowel 4, disk 3 is along the circumferential direction evenly provided with 3 dowels 4, arc strip 5 connects plate body 1 by contiguous block, annular through groove 6 is formed between disk 3 and arc 5, arc elongated slot 7 is provided with between arc strip 5 and plate body 1, u shape opening 8 is provided with between adjacent arc strip 5, plate body 1 inverse layer structure is all levels, plate body 1 front position disk 3, dowel 4 and arc strip 5 all relatively plate body carry out sinking 0.05mm structural design,
During utility model works, disk 3 is provided with in the middle part of plate body 1, disk 3 can play the effect of connection circuit, disk 3 is connected on arc strip 5 by dowel 4, annular gap is formed between disk 3 and arc strip 5, while guarantee structural strength and connection characteristic, material can be saved, structure is easier, arc elongated slot 7 is provided with between arc strip 5 and plate body 1, u shape opening 8 is provided with between adjacent arc strip 5, at plate body 1 reverse side position disk 3, dowel 4 and arc strip 5 are all on same level height with plate body 1, plate body 1 front position disk 3, dowel 4 and arc strip 5 adopt sink structures to design, then disk 3, dowel 4 and arc strip 5 reduce 0.05mm with plate body 1 place plane, be more applicable for the joint of battery, connect more solid and reliable, connection characteristic is better.
